Will Arnett strikes deal for Fox series

LOS ANGELES (Hollywood Reporter) - "Arrested Development" co-star Will Arnett is back at Fox with a deal to star in a new comedy project for the network.

The pact is said to be more far-reaching than a typical development deal, giving Arnett complete creative control over the writers, producers and directors he chooses to work with as well as over the content of the show that will be developed for him.

The deal is not tied to any studio, with writers from various outlets expected to pitch him ideas. Considered a likely collaborator is "Arrested" creator Mitch Hurwitz, with whom Arnett has said he wants to work again. Arnett provides voice-over for Hurwitz's new animated comedy for Fox, "Sit Down, Shut Up."

Arnett's wife, Amy Poehler of "SNL," also is primetime-bound, with a starring role on a midseason comedy on

NBC.
